The contract pertains to the procurement of 54 gaskets with NSN 5330-01-302-9947 and part number 12358949, sourced exclusively from approved suppliers, currently limited to Donaldson Company Inc. All suppliers must comply with the latest revision of the original equipment manufacturer’s drawing and meet MIL-STD-130N identification marking standards for U.S. military property. The item must be free of asbestos as defined by FED-STD-313. Unapproved suppliers are required to secure formal source approval from the OEM and submit supporting documentation including a source approval request, technical data package, or proof of prior approval alongside their offer. The solicitation, identified as SPE7L3-26-T-147L, was posted on August 4, 2026, with responses due by August 17, 2026, and requires delivery within 21 days of award to Texarkana, Texas, 75507-5000. Technical and quality requirements are govern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with the revision effective on the solicitation issue date controlling for this simplified acquisition. The contracting activity falls under the Department of Defense, Land Supplier Operations Vehicle Support, with primary point of contact Amber Rohly reachable via email and phone provided.
